BAS Programmer
Job Title: BAS Programmer – Commercial Building Automation
Location: Richmond, VA
Salary:
Mid-Level: $85,000–$95,000
Senior-Level: $95,000–$115,000 + Overtime
Experience: 3–8+ years with BAS programming and control system integration
Availability: Full-time, occasional overtime as needed
Start Date: Immediate openings available
✅ Benefits
Health, dental, and vision insurance
401(k) with company match
Paid vacation and holidays
Company vehicle and gas card
Short- and long-term disability insurance
Ongoing training & career growth opportunities
About the Role
We're looking for a skilled BAS Programmer to join our Richmond team. This role is ideal for someone who enjoys writing control logic from scratch, coding sequences of operation, and deploying scalable building automation systems. You'll work directly with Niagara (Tridium, AX, N4), and open protocols like BACnet and Modbus.
You’ll partner closely with engineers and project managers to bring complex systems to life across commercial and industrial environments—while continuing to grow in a supportive, fast-paced team.
✅ Responsibilities
Program and commission building automation systems using Niagara (Tridium, AX, N4)
Write and modify control logic and sequences of operation in BAS platforms
Integrate BACnet, Modbus, and other open protocols for HVAC, lighting, and energy systems
Develop and test custom code/scripts to meet unique project specifications
Collaborate with engineers, PMs, and field techs during system startup and commissioning
Maintain thorough project documentation, logic diagrams, and as-built records
Troubleshoot code and system communication issues during and after deployment
✅ Requirements
3–8+ years of hands-on BAS programming experience
Proficient in writing control logic and working within Niagara (Tridium AX & N4 preferred)
Experience with open communication protocols: BACnet, Modbus, etc.
Strong foundation in control sequences, logic diagrams, and automation design
Familiarity with software tools like Workbench, Sedona, or equivalent
Niagara Tridium AX or N4 Certification strongly preferred
Excellent communication and collaboration skills
Must be detail-oriented with strong documentation habits
Who This Job Is For
Experienced BAS Programmers ready to step into a technical leadership track
Professionals who enjoy writing code and taking systems from concept to deployment
Techs with Niagara AX/N4 experience looking for long-term growth
Candidates who thrive in fast-paced environments and take pride in quality work
Requirements
3–8+ years of hands-on BAS programming experience
Proficient in writing control logic and working within Niagara (Tridium AX & N4 preferred)
Experience with open communication protocols: BACnet, Modbus, etc.
Strong foundation in control sequences, logic diagrams, and automation design
Familiarity with software tools like Workbench, Sedona, or equivalent
Niagara Tridium AX or N4 Certification strongly preferred
Excellent communication and collaboration skills
Must be detail-oriented with strong documentation habits
Benefits
Health, dental, and vision insurance
401(k) with company match
Paid vacation and holidays
Company vehicle and gas card
Short- and long-term disability insurance
Ongoing training & career growth opportunities
Recommended Jobs
DOT Deputy Program Manager
Savan is seeking a Deputy Program Manager to support a Department of Transportation (DoT) program in the federal civilian space. The role is responsible for supporting account growth, capture, and lon…
Lead Solutions Architect - Cloud as a Service
Program Overview About The Role Within Peraton’s Space and Intel sector, there is an immediate need for a cleared Lead Solution Architect (LSA) to support growth opportunities within the US …
Summer 2026 Sales Engineering Intern
SZNS Solutions LLC is excited to offer a Summer 2025 Sales Engineer Intern position as part of our dynamic team focused on helping customers transform and build what's next for their business — with …
Data Architect and DBA
Job Title: Data Architect / SQL Database Administrator ONSITE Downtown, Richmond, VA (1 day remote) Location: Richmond, VA (On-site with 1 day hybrid) Department: Information Technology / …
Project Manager
Overview: Martins Construction, a Posillico Company, is one of the Mid-Atlantic region’s most prominent general contractors in heavy highway and bridge construction. Reinforcing that reputation is th…
Associate Human Resources Business Partner
Our not-so-secret sauce. Award-winning, inclusive, Top Workplace culture doesn’t happen overnight. It’s a result of hard work by extraordinary people. The industry’s brightest talent drives our ef…
Deputy Sheriff
Welcome to Henry County, Virginia. One of the keys to our success is hiring good employees. Our employees are dedicated, service oriented individuals working together to serve our community. If you a…
Embedded Software Developer - Regular and Alternative Schedule
The Software Developer works closely with Engineers, Designers and other Engineering personnel in the designing, writing, and debugging of software for embedded systems, components, and support tools…
Customer Service Representative - Alexandria Animal Hospital of Fort Hunt
Overview Be the first smile they see. The voice they trust. The heart of our front desk. At Alexandria Animal Hospital of Fort Hunt , we're more than just a veterinary clinic - we're a team…
Senior Preconstruction Estimator
F.H. Paschen has over 115 years of experience in the construction industry. You’ve driven on highways we paved, you’ve travelled through airports we modernized, you’ve commuted through rail stations …